Dissolvable Frac Plugs for Enhanced Well Control

Wiki Article

In the realm of hydraulic fracturing operations, achieving optimal well control is paramount. Biodegradable frac plugs present a cutting-edge solution to this challenge by providing a robust means of segmenting zones within the wellbore. These innovative plugs are designed to dissolve over time, removing the need for conventional retrieval methods. By improving well control, dissolvable frac plugs contribute to a predictable fracking process, minimizing production risks and maximizing overall output.

Temperature-Resilient Frac Plugs

The rigorous nature of high-temperature zones often presents a substantial obstacle to efficient well completion. Standard frac plugs, designed for lower temperatures, are prone to breakdown in these extreme conditions, jeopardizing the integrity of the wellbore and causing costly operational issues. High-temperature dissolvable frac plugs offer a effective solution by withstanding elevated temperatures while ensuring controlled insertion and timely dissolution once the stimulation process is complete.

HPHT Dissolvable Frac Plugs: Addressing High-Pressure, High-Temperature Completion Challenges

Completing wells in high-pressure, high-temperature (HPHT) environments presents substantial challenges for the oil and gas industry. Traditional frac plugs often struggle to withstand these extreme conditions, leading to potential wellbore damage, reduced production, and increased operational risks. However, HPHT dissolvable frac plugs offer a innovative approach to overcome these obstacles.

These specialized plugs are designed to resist the stresses of HPHT wells while ensuring reliable isolation during hydraulic fracturing operations. Upon completion, they effectively dissolve, eliminating the need for retrieval and reducing environmental impact.

Advanced Technology: Dissolvable Frac Plugs Optimized for Complex Formations

The extraction industry is constantly seeking innovations to en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of fracking operations. One such development involves the use of sophisticated dissolvable frac plugs specifically tailored for unconventional formations. These plugs play a critical role in controlling fluid flow during fracking operations.

Traditional frac plugs often involve major challenges when dealing with heterogeneous formations. They can become lodged, causing blockages and hindering the effectiveness of the fracking process. Dissolvable frac plugs, however, present a novel solution by eroding over time, allowing for smooth fluid flow through the formation.

This technology is particularly beneficial in formations with limited channels or intricate configurations. The plugs can be precisely positioned to segment different zones within the formation, ensuring that fluid is directed to the desired target.

Robust Isolation with Superior Dissolvable Frac Plugs

In the demanding realm of hydraulic fracturing operations, plug and perf achieving reliable isolation between zones is paramount for maximizing production and mitigating risks. Dissolvable frac plugs have emerged as a crucial technology to address this challenge, offering superior control and minimizing the potential for wellbore integrity issues. These innovative plugs are designed to thoroughly seal off target intervals during fracturing treatments, preventing fluid migration and ensuring that proppant is placed precisely where it's needed. Upon completion of the fracturing process, the plugs dissolve over time, restoring fluid flow and allowing for uninterrupted production.

Introducing the Next Generation of Frac Plugs: Dissolvable Solutions for Superior Well Integrity

The oil and gas industry always seeks innovative technologies to enhance well performance and mitigate environmental impact. A breakthrough in this realm is the emergence of dissolvable frac plugs, a cutting-edge approach that promises superior well integrity compared to traditional methods. These advanced plugs are designed to thoroughly dissolve over time, eliminating the need for costly and time-consuming retrieval operations. This advancement offers a myriad of benefits, including reduced operational risks, minimized debris, and enhanced reservoir productivity.

Dissolvable frac plugs are manufactured from proprietary materials that degrade naturally under the prevailing well conditions. Once the fracking process is complete, these plugs dissolve at a controlled rate, ensuring a clean and unobstructed flow path for hydrocarbons. This eliminates the potential for restrictions that can deteriorate well productivity over time.

The adoption of dissolvable frac plugs represents a paradigm shift in well construction practices, paving the way for a more sustainable and efficient future for the oil and gas industry.
